助记词安全性分析:破解可能性与预防措施
- By Tp官方正版下载
- 2026-02-03 10:57:39
在现代数字经济中,助记词(Mnemonic Phrase)作为一种用于加密货币钱包和其他安全系统中的身份验证手段,受到越来越多人的关注。助记词通常是由12到24个随机生成的单词组成,用户可以通过这些单词轻松地恢复他们的私钥或钱包。然而,在信息安全日趋严峻的今天,关于助记词是否会被破解这一问题引发了广泛的讨论。
## 助记词的基本概念与重要性
### 什么是助记词?
助记词是指用户使用的一组单词,旨在简化复杂的加密密钥,使其更容易记住和输入。通常,这些单词是通过某种算法生成的,它们用于产生用户的钱包地址和私钥。大多数加密货币钱包(如比特币和以太坊)都使用助记词来进行密钥管理。
### 助记词的重要性
1. **安全性**:助记词是用户控制加密货币的关键,一旦丢失或者被盗,用户将失去对其资产的完全控制。
2. **便捷性**:相较于直接使用长串的随机字符,助记词更易于人们记忆和书写,尤其是在涉及到加密货币这样的高复杂度环境中。
3. **恢复功能**:助记词可以在用户的设备丢失或损坏时,帮助他们恢复钱包和资产。
## 助记词的破解可能性
尽管助记词作为一种安全存储方式被广泛采用,但它们是否会被破解依然是一个值得探讨的问题。这里我们从几个方面分析助记词的安全性。
### 助记词的生成算法
助记词是通过确定的算法生成的,如BIP39(比特币改进提案39)。这个算法确保生成的助记词具有高度的随机性和不可预测性。根据BIP39的设计,助记词是基于一定数量的熵值生成的,熵值越高,破解的难度越大。
### 破解的技术手段
1. **暴力破解(Brute Force)**:暴力破解是通过尝试所有可能的组合来获取助记词。由于助记词通常由12至24个单词组成,从2048个备选单词中选择,破解的时间和资源耗费是巨大的,几乎不可能在合理的时间内完成。
2. **字典攻击(Dictionary Attack)**:这是一种利用已知的单词列表进行攻击的方式。尽管字典攻击在某些情况下有效,但由于助记词的组合复杂性,依然难以奏效。
3. **社会工程学(Social Engineering)**:攻击者可以通过社交工程手段获取用户的助记词,例如假冒客服等方式。尽管这是破解的可能路径之一,但依赖于用户的不安全行为。
### 助记词的安全性评估
从技术层面来看,采用现代加密算法和良好的随机性生成过程,助记词的破解在理论上是极为困难的。然而,当用户自己保管助记词不当或者将其暴露的情况下,安全性则会大打折扣。
## 预防破解的有效措施
### 定期更换助记词
用户可以定期更换助记词,以增加安全性。此时需要确保新的助记词的安全存储,以避免意外损失。
### 使用硬件钱包
硬件钱包提供了一个安全的氛围来存储助记词和私钥。即使计算机被感染,也无法直接访问存储在硬件钱包中的数据。
### 不在在线环境中存储助记词
尽量避免在云存储、社交媒体等在线平台记录助记词。如果非要记录,可以选择纸质记录并存放在安全的地方。
### 启用双因素认证(2FA)
为钱包账号启用双因素认证可以增加一层保护,即使助记词被盗取,也难以通过层层的安全防线访问资产。
### 教育和提高安全意识
教育是避免安全事故的最佳手段之一。用户应当熟悉加密货币的安全性和潜在风险,提高安全意识,谨慎处理助记词。
---
## 常见问题解答
### 助记词能否被遗忘?
助记词是设计用来便于记忆的,但如果使用者没有及时记录或因记忆力下降而遗忘,这确实可能导致无法恢复钱包。在此情况下,重要的是要将助记词记录在安全的地方。
### 有什么方法可以安全地存储助记词?
用户可以选择将助记词置于耐火安全箱中,或者分开存放在几个不同区域以防丢失或被盗。同时,可以考虑使用种子短语转换器将助记词转化为易记的短语。
### 助记词被盗后该怎么办?
如果助记词被盗,用户应立即改变钱包密码,并寻找可用的紧急方案来移转资产。同时,应当寻找法律协助,报告盗窃。
### 是否有专门的软件可以检测助记词的安全性?
现在市场上有一些安全性评估工具,可以用于检查助记词的复杂性和安全性。这些工具可以帮助用户了解自己的助记词是否易被猜测。
### 助记词对于 NFT 钱包的重要性?
助记词不仅适用于加密货币钱包,也同样适用于 NFT 钱包。用户可以使用助记词来恢复他们的 NFT 收藏品,因此保存好助记词始终至关重要。
---
通过以上分析,可以看出助记词作为一种安全性较高的密钥存储方式,虽然在技术上难以破解,但仍面临用户自身管理不当或社交工程等风险。用户应时刻保持警惕,并通过各种安全措施来进一步保护自己的加密资产和助记词的安全。